1. A scanning probe system comprising:

  • a probe comprising a cantilever extending from a base to a free end, and a probe tip carried by the free end of the cantilever;

    a first driver with a first driver input, the first driver arranged to drive the probe in accordance with a first drive signal at the first driver input;

    a second driver with a second driver input, the second driver arranged to drive the probe in accordance with a second drive signal at the second driver input;

    a control system arranged to control the first drive signal so that the first driver drives the base of the cantilever repeatedly towards and away from a surface of a sample in a series of cycles; and

    a surface detector arranged to generate a surface signal for each cycle when the surface detector detects an interaction of the probe tip with the surface of the sample, wherein the control system is also arranged to modify the second drive signal in response to receipt of the surface signal from the surface detector, the modification of the second drive signal causing the second driver to control the probe tip, and the control system is arranged to control the first drive signal so that for each cycle there is an approach phase before generation of the surface signal in which the first driver moves the base of the cantilever and the probe tip towards the surface of the sample, and a retract phase after generation of the surface signal in which the first driver moves the base of the cantilever and the probe tip away from the surface of the sample, wherein modification of the second drive signal causes the cantilever to deform so that an angle of the probe tip changes relative to the base of the cantilever; and

    wherein the control system is arranged to control the second drive signal so that for each cycle the second drive signal remains substantially constant as the probe tip moves towards the surface of the sample until the second drive signal is modified in response to receipt of the surface signal, thereby ensuring that when the surface signal is generated the probe tip is at a predetermined angle relative to the base of the cantilever.
